About the role

As a Higher Level Teaching Assistant, you will work closely with class teachers, SENCOs, and external specialists to implement support strategies tailored to individual learners. You will provide targeted academic, emotional, and behavioural support, helping to raise achievement and promote positive outcomes across all key stages. This is a rewarding and dynamic role for someone who is proactive, skilled in inclusive practice, and committed to improving life chances for young people.

Key Responsibilities
  • Provide one-to-one and small group support for pupils with a range of SEND, including ASD, ADHD, SEMH, and learning difficulties.
  • Deliver targeted interventions in literacy, numeracy, communication, and social skills.
  • Assist in planning and adapting classroom activities to ensure accessibility and engagement for all learners.
  • Monitor, assess, and record pupil progress and behaviour, feeding back to staff and parents/carers as appropriate.
  • Work collaboratively with teaching staff, therapists, and support services to implement EHCP targets and personalised learning plans.
  • Support transitions, both within school and between educational settings.
  • Contribute to the development of inclusive teaching resources and strategies.
